Outline:

This training session is part of the Early Years Teaching and Learning Training Framework and The Lloyd Park Centre will be leading the session on how to support children's learning and development across all areas of the EYFS in an outdoor environment

Description:

Course aims:
To explore practitioners' understanding of risks and hazards and unpick any unhelpful barriers and constraints about outdoor risk-taking play.
Course Delivery:
Introductions will take place in a training room, followed by direct experience of working with children and families in an outdoor playspace, followed by group and individual reflection within a classroom.

Outcome:

Practitioners will feel confident in supporting children's learning and development across all areas of the EYFS in an outdoor environment
